The new-look library newsletter will be relaunched under Books & the City. Different from the past newsletters that merely reported library services and event contents, a large number of materials relating to ‘reading’ - like authors’ book remarks and columns, further reading, in-depth reports and information about publication trends, etc. - will be added in the new version.
“Safeguarding Library” is the special topic planned for the first issue of this newsletter. The library is a repository of knowledge consisting of diverse views, various mediums, different generations as well as knowledge and stories from innumerable fields. Nevertheless, every person’s capture of information and views differ here; via individual reading, feeling, interpretation, digestion, assimilation, accumulation and inspiration, we understand others’ world views while establishing our own identities. 
Knowledge becomes significant only through sharing, inheritance and recurrent transmission. We hope that by reading we improve, and that human conscience and knowledge will promote the beauty and well-being of the world.
